Key Market Insights
  • Infrastructure Evolution: Modern AI infrastructure differs fundamentally through specialized layers for Context Retrieval, Processing, and Management
  • Investment Scale: Tech giants committed over $300B collectively in 2025, with Microsoft ($80B), Meta ($65B), and Amazon ($100B+) leading
  • Supply Constraints: Data center vacancy rates at record-low 1.9% with procurement timelines exceeding 24 months
  • Energy Impact: Data center electricity consumption forecast to double to 4% of global usage by 2030

This report synthesizes analysis from over 50 industry sources, market research reports, and corporate announcements. Data represents the most current available information as of September 2025.

💰 Major 2025 Investment Commitments

Stargate Initiative – $500B

OpenAI, SoftBank, Oracle joint venture to create largest AI infrastructure network, targeting 100,000 US jobs.

Microsoft – $80B

AI-enabled data centers with over half focused in US, building UK’s largest supercomputer with 23,000 NVIDIA GPUs.

Meta – $65B

Building data center “large enough to cover significant part of Manhattan” with 1.3M+ GPUs by end 2025.

Amazon – $100B+

AWS infrastructure expansion including custom AI training chips Trainium and Inferentia, $30B+ in new US data centers.

Alibaba – $52.4B

Largest private-sector computing infrastructure investment in China over next three years.

France – $112B

European response to establish continent as next-generation computing hub, competing with US investments.

Strategic Risk Assessment

⚠️ Infrastructure & Supply Chain Risks

Supply Chain Vulnerability

Global AI supply chain concentrated in China, Europe, North America for R&D, with semiconductor manufacturing in East Asia and US creating geopolitical exposure.

Geopolitical Risk

Capacity Constraints

Delays tied to skilled labor, supply chains, and utility access pushing procurement timelines beyond 24 months for large capacity requirements.

24+ Month Delays

Energy Sustainability

Electric and gas utility capex expected to surpass $1T over next 5 years. Data center consumption could reach 4% of global energy by 2030.

$1T Utility Capex
